Early Life and Entry into Destiny’s Child
LeToya Nicole Luckett was born in Houston, Texas, and began performing in local church and community settings as a child. In the late 1990s, she joined what became the original lineup of Destiny’s Child alongside Beyoncé Knowles, Kelly Rowland, and LaTavia Roberson. The group signed with Columbia Records through Mathew Knowles and Music World Entertainment. During this period, the group released several multi-platinum singles and albums, establishing a foundation that would shape the sound of late 1990s and early 2000s R&B and pop.
Key Early Milestones
- 1997: Destiny’s Child forms as a quartet including LeToya Luckett.
- 1998: Debut single "No, No, No" charts, introducing the group to a national audience.
- 1999: Release of debut self-titled album Destiny’s Child, featuring Luckett on key vocal parts.
Solo Music Career and Artistic Identity
After departing Destiny’s Child, LeToya Luckett launched a solo career. She released her debut self-titled album in 2006, which included the single "Torn" and showcased a blend of contemporary R&B with classic soul influences. Subsequent projects, including Lady Love (2009) and later independent releases, reflected continued artistic experimentation. Her solo work is noted for vocal control, personal lyricism, and varied production choices, maintaining a presence in the R&B landscape.
